What Gotham Steel Cookware Is Made Of And Why It Matters
Gotham Steel cookware typically features an aluminum core with a ceramic-based nonstick coating. Aluminum is lightweight and heats quickly, which helps with even cooking and faster meal prep. However, aluminum alone is soft and not highly durable, so it relies on the coating for protection and food release.
The ceramic surface is often reinforced with titanium or diamond-like particles to improve scratch resistance. Most product lines promote being PFOA and PFOS-free, which addresses common safety concerns related to older nonstick technologies.
Because it is aluminum-based rather than fully clad stainless steel, this cookware is lighter and easier to handle. That makes it practical for everyday meals but less suited for heavy searing or constant high-heat use.

Is Gotham Steel Cookware of Good Quality?
Concerns usually stem from performance changes over time. Here is how common issues develop.
Cause 1: Frequent High Heat Cooking
Effect: Faster coating wear
Ceramic coatings break down more quickly under repeated high temperatures. Cooking on maximum heat daily can shorten lifespan.
Cause 2: Metal Utensils
Effect: Scratching and reduced nonstick ability
Even reinforced coatings can develop micro-scratches from metal tools, which leads to sticking.
Cause 3: Dishwasher Overuse
Effect: Gradual surface deterioration
Although labeled dishwasher safe, harsh detergents and high heat cycles can weaken the coating over time.
Cause 4: Incorrect Expectations
Effect: Perceived low quality
Comparing lightweight ceramic cookware to heavy stainless steel sets creates unrealistic standards.
Most negative feedback about Gotham Steel nonstick cookware is tied to misuse, heat exposure, or surface damage, not immediate structural failure.

Is Gotham Steel Cookware Safe and Non-Toxic?
| Concern | Cause | Practical Reality |
|---|---|---|
| Are Gotham Steel pans toxic | Worry about chemical coatings | Most lines are marketed as PFOA and PFOS free |
| Coating chipping | High heat or scratching | Surface damage affects performance more than safety |
| Cooking fumes | Extremely high temperatures | Rare during normal home cooking |
Ceramic-based nonstick does not rely on older PTFE formulations in many product lines. Under normal temperatures, it does not release harmful substances.
When the coating becomes heavily scratched, replacement is recommended. This is primarily because food begins sticking and cooking becomes uneven, not because of immediate toxicity concerns.
Used within recommended temperature limits, the cookware meets common US safety standards for ceramic nonstick products.

How To Make Gotham Steel Cookware Last Longer
Follow these practical steps to extend durability:
Step 1: Cook On Medium Heat
Use high heat only for boiling liquids.
Step 2: Add A Small Amount Of Oil
A thin layer of oil supports surface protection and improves results.
Step 3: Use Silicone Or Wooden Utensils
This prevents scratches that reduce nonstick performance.
Step 4: Allow Cooling Before Washing
Rapid temperature changes stress coatings.
Step 5: Hand Wash When Possible
Mild soap and a soft sponge help preserve the surface.
The single biggest improvement most households see comes from lowering heat settings. Ceramic coatings respond best to moderate temperatures.
Common Mistakes That Damage Gotham Steel Nonstick Cookware
Avoid these frequent errors:
- Cooking on high heat every day
- Preheating an empty pan for extended periods
- Using aerosol cooking sprays repeatedly
- Scrubbing with abrasive pads or steel wool
- Stacking pans without protective layers
The most harmful practice is dry preheating at high heat, which accelerates coating breakdown.
Treat the cookware as ceramic-coated aluminum rather than heavy stainless steel. That adjustment prevents most long-term problems.
Induction Compatibility And Oven Safety Explained
Induction Compatibility
Not every Gotham Steel cookware model is induction-ready. Only versions with a magnetic stainless steel base plate will function on induction cooktops. Always confirm specifications before purchasing.
Oven Safety
Many pieces are oven safe up to around 500 degrees Fahrenheit. However, lid materials may have lower heat limits. Check the handle and lid guidelines before baking.
Dishwasher Use
Although labeled dishwasher safe, frequent cycles may reduce coating longevity. Hand washing is a safer long-term option.
Frequently Asked Questions
Is Gotham Steel Cookware Good For Everyday Use?
Yes, it performs well for everyday meals such as eggs, vegetables, pasta, and light sautéing. It heats quickly and cleans easily. However, for repeated high-heat searing, heavier stainless steel cookware may offer greater long-term durability.
Are Gotham Steel Pans Toxic When Scratched?
Scratches mainly reduce nonstick effectiveness. The cookware is marketed as non-toxic and free from PFOA and PFOS. When the coating becomes heavily worn, replacement is recommended to maintain cooking performance.
Is Gotham Steel Cookware Made In The USA?
Manufacturing locations vary by product line. Many ceramic nonstick brands are produced internationally while distributing in the US market. Check packaging or official specifications for exact origin details.
How Long Does Gotham Steel Nonstick Last?
With proper care and moderate heat use, ceramic nonstick surfaces can last several years. Frequent high heat, metal utensils, and harsh cleaning shorten lifespan significantly.
Is Gotham Steel Cookware Dishwasher Safe?
Most lines are labeled dishwasher safe. However, consistent hand washing helps maintain the coating and extends usability over time.
